CC   -!- FUNCTION: Key enzyme involved in DNA replication and DNA repair.
CC       Involved in Okazaki fragments processing by cleaving long flaps that
CC       escape FEN1: flaps that are longer than 27 nucleotides are coated by
CC       replication protein A complex (RPA), leading to recruit DNA2 which
CC       cleaves the flap until it is too short to bind RPA and becomes a
CC       substrate for FEN1. Also involved in 5'-end resection of DNA during
CC       double-strand break (DSB) repair by mediating the cleavage of 5'-ssDNA.
CC       {ECO:0000256|RuleBase:RU367041}.
